Yuki Kobayashi is reported to have turned down a loan move to HJK Helsinki.

The defender hasn’t played a minute of competitive football this season and is currently sixth choice central defender.

With his contract expiring at Vissel Kobe at the end of 2022 he joined Celtic on a five year contract with the loan deal for Moritz Jenz cut short.

The decision to put Cameron Carter-Vickers in for a knee operation at the end of April provided Kobayashi with the chance to impress but heavy defeats at Ibrox and Easter Road seems to have ended his Celtic career after six appearances.

On Monday Football Scotland reported:

HJK Helsinki attempted to take Yuki Kobayashi on loan from Celtic,Football Scotland understands.

The Japanese defender looked set to be one of the fringe men offloaded during the January window with his homeland and the MLS thought to be likely destinations. It has now been revealed though that the Finnish side, where the Hoops previously loaned Conor Hazard, were in for him.

It never went further than that though and Kobayashi remains at Parkhead. The Finnish transfer window remains open until next month so the move could still be resurrected if Helsinki revisit their interest in the 23-year-old.

With the MLS transfer window open until April it appears that Kobayashi is holding out for a move to the States rather than the Finnish League.

After being overlooked by Postecoglou and Brendan Rodgers it seems certain that the Celtic career of the 23-year-old is over, but the next step remains unknown with the player holding the aces with a Celtic contract running until May 2028.
